Exemestane as Neoadjuvant Hormonotherapy for Locally Advanced Breast Cancer: Results of a Phase II Trial
2007
Background: Neoadjuvant hormonotherapy has recently been used for downstaging large or locally advanced (LA) breast cancer in postmenopausal women. Patients and Methods: A phase II study was conducted in postmenopausal, hormone-receptor (HR) positive, T2-T4 patients, receiving 25 mg/day exemestane for 16 weeks. Results: Among 42 patients, 57.1% underwent conservative surgery. The clinical objective response rate (ORR) was 73.3%, without progression. A pathological partial response was achieved in 16.7% of the patients. Exemestane significantly reduced the expression of Ki-67 and progesterone receptors (PgR) (p<0.001). A significant decrease in PgR was correlated with clinical ORR (p=0.028). The responders presented higher baseline PgR levels (p=0.017). No relationship was found between ORR and mRNA expression of aromatase or oestrogen receptors ‚ (ER- ‚). Conclusion: Neoadjuvant exemestane provided satisfactory efficacy and safety profiles in LA breast cancer. The main biological effects consisted of a reduction in PgR expression for responders and a decrease in Ki-67 expression.
